I am Vikas, Welcome to the forums. 6000 worth of debt can be paid with ease; a little simple calculation is required.
Calculate your total monthly expenses (including debt payments): X
Calculate your total monthly income: Y
Y-X will give your monthly dispensable income, which you can use to speed up your debt payments. If the monthly dispensable income is not enough to pay off debts then try negotiating with your creditors for a deal with reduced amount, lower interest rate.

Whenever I cash my paycheck, I make piles: food, bills (individual piles), gas, and maybe a small pile for recreation. This is an organized way to establish set dollar amounts for each bill.
